docker下载ubuntu失败怎么办

PHPz
PHPz 原创
2023-04-25 09:31:32 176浏览

Docker是一种流行的虚拟化技术,它可以让用户在一个隔离的容器中运行应用程序,同时使得应用程序更加便携和易于管理。但是,在使用Docker时,很多用户都会遇到一个常见的问题:下载Ubuntu镜像失败。

下载Ubuntu镜像失败的原因有很多,可能是网络问题、镜像源不可用、访问限制等。今天,我们将探讨这个问题的一些解决方法,帮助你在使用Docker时避免这个问题。

一、检查网络连接

首先,你需要检查网络连接是否正常。Docker拉取镜像需要使用网络连接,如果网络出现故障或者访问速度过慢,则会导致镜像下载失败。你可以尝试使用浏览器或者其他工具检查网络连接是否正常,例如ping命令或traceroute命令等。

如果你发现网络连接存在问题,那么你需要先解决网络问题,例如调整网络设置、更换网络连接等。

二、更换镜像源

如果网络连接正常,但是下载Ubuntu镜像仍然失败,那么你可以尝试更换镜像源。默认情况下,Docker使用的镜像源是Docker官方提供的,但是这个源可能会出现访问限制或者不稳定等问题。

你可以考虑使用其他可靠的镜像源,例如阿里云镜像源、华为镜像源等。更换镜像源的方式也很简单,只需要在Docker命令后面加上--registry-mirror选项即可,例如:

$ docker pull --registry-mirror=https://xxxxxx.mirror.aliyuncs.com ubuntu

这个命令将会从阿里云镜像源下载Ubuntu镜像,代替Docker官方提供的源。

三、使用VPN

如果网络连接正常,但是下载Ubuntu镜像仍然失败,那么你可以考虑使用VPN来解决问题。VPN可以模拟出一种新的网络环境,从而跳过一些网络限制,让你更加顺畅地访问网络。

你可以选择免费或付费的VPN服务,并根据VPN服务提供商的说明进行设置。

四、手动下载Ubuntu镜像

如果前面的方法都没有解决下载Ubuntu镜像的问题,那么你可以尝试手动下载Ubuntu镜像并导入到Docker中。手动下载镜像的方法也很简单,你可以打开Ubuntu官网或其他可靠的下载网站,找到对应的Ubuntu版本,然后下载对应的tar文件。

下载完成后,你可以使用Docker的命令来导入镜像,例如:

$ docker load -i ubuntu.tar

这个命令将会把下载的Ubuntu镜像导入到Docker中,然后你就可以使用这个镜像了。

总结:

无论是下载Ubuntu镜像失败还是其他Docker问题,我们应该首先确定问题所在,然后采取相应的解决方法。如果你遇到了下载Ubuntu镜像失败的问题,可以根据我们提供的方法来尝试解决,相信你一定会找到解决问题的办法。

以上就是docker下载ubuntu失败怎么办的详细内容,更多请关注php中文网其它相关文章!

声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n核实处理。